Peter Acworth, CEO of San Francisco fetish-porn giant Kink.com, has made a fortune from BDSM and maintained a surprising respectability while doing it. Just last month brought the Sundance premier of Kink, a James Franco-produced documentary that glorifies Acworth’s sprawling, filthy empire. But now we’ve learned that Acworth was arrested earlier this month for cocaine possession, by police investigating a report that people were shooting firearms inside the company’s Mission District headquarters. Acworth, 42, was arrested at 8:24 p.m. on February 1st and charged with one count of cocaine possession and one count of delaying arrest, according to Albie Esparaza, a San Francisco Police Department Public-Information Officer. Police were initially sent to Kink.com’s massive, $14.5 million studio/dungeon in the old San Francisco Armory at 1800 Mission St. after a concerned citizen reported seeing a video online of men firing guns inside the premises, Esparaza said. Joshua Carlberg, 40, was also arrested and charged with delaying arrest.
